Improvements in Robotics



One major development in dental surgery is making use of robotic technology, which enables accurate and efficient surgeries. With the help of robot systems, dental cosmetic surgeons have the ability to perform intricate surgical procedures with enhanced precision, minimizing the risk of human mistake.



These robot systems are equipped with sophisticated imaging modern technology and specific instruments that make it possible for specialists to browse with complex anatomical structures effortlessly. By utilizing robot innovation, cosmetic surgeons can accomplish greater medical accuracy, resulting in boosted client results and faster recovery times.

Furthermore, using robotics in dental surgery allows for minimally intrusive procedures, lowering the injury to bordering cells and advertising faster recovery.

3D Printing in Dental Surgery



To enhance the area of oral surgery, you can check out the subtopic of 3D printing in oral surgery. This innovative innovation has the possible to change the means oral specialists run and deal with individuals. Below are four essential methods which 3D printing is shaping the field:

- ** Personalized Surgical Guides **: 3D printing permits the production of extremely exact and patient-specific surgical overviews, enhancing the accuracy and performance of procedures.

- ** Implant Prosthetics **: With 3D printing, oral specialists can produce personalized implant prosthetics that completely fit a client's special anatomy, leading to much better results and individual contentment.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, minimizing the need for conventional grafting methods and improving healing and recovery time.

- ** Education and learning and Educating **: 3D printing can be made use of to produce practical medical versions for instructional objectives, permitting oral doctors to practice intricate procedures before doing them on people.

With its prospective to enhance accuracy, personalization, and training, 3D printing is an amazing advancement in the field of oral surgery.

Minimally Invasive Strategies



To better progress the area of oral surgery, welcome the potential of minimally invasive techniques that can greatly benefit both surgeons and patients alike.

Minimally intrusive strategies are reinventing the area by minimizing surgical trauma, lessening post-operative discomfort, and speeding up the healing process. These techniques involve using smaller sized lacerations and specialized tools to perform procedures with accuracy and efficiency.

By making use of innovative imaging modern technology, such as cone light beam calculated tomography (CBCT), specialists can properly intend and execute surgeries with minimal invasiveness.

Furthermore, using lasers in dental surgery permits specific cells cutting and coagulation, leading to lessened blood loss and reduced healing time.

With minimally invasive strategies, individuals can experience quicker healing, decreased scarring, and improved results, making it an essential element of the future of oral surgery.
